PC Does Not Power Up
A couple of days ago, my PC died while i was gaming. Graphics disappeared from the monitor, but everything (fans + power & HD LEDs) was still on. I tried turning it off, leaving it for a night and turning it back on, everything powered up but there was no activity on the monitor or any usual BIOS start up beeps. The HD activity LED was constantly on, whereas normally it would blink at start up.
The same problem persisted, so i decided to make a new PC. I got a new motherboard and CPU, and connected everything according to the manual. (I built the PC that "died" before.) The first time i turned on the power swith, the exact same thing happened as when i turned on the old PC. After about 30 seconds, the fans stopped running and LEDs went off. I believe he PC powered off itself. However, i could not turn power back on after that. I am wondering what could possibly be the cause of this. Could i have fried the motherboard and/or CPU? How could i test this? Side note, the old PC stopped powering on as well. |
